I was searching through the Coats & Clark website today and found some information about a new program coming on PBS. It is called "Knit & Crochet Today" and is being hosted by Kassie DePaiva who plays Blair on One Life to Live.

http://www.coatsandclark.com/Crafts/Knitting/Features/Knitting+and+Crochet+Today+TV+Show.htm

 

If you sign up for their newsletter, it will keep you informed on when the show will begin. You can contact your PBS station (they give the lists of PBS stations in your area) to ask them to add the show to their line-up.

 

When you sign up for the newsletter, they also provide you with a free pattern for a beautiful "Beaded Lacy Purse".
